Hi, Thank you for your answers. I was reacting emotionally to this situation.

My question regarding my hub payments was: can his ex wife pursue legal actions for him not paying on the first day of every month? He has no delayed payments.
If there is a court order in place stating that payments are due on the 1st of the month, she can take him to court for contempt. If it's a pattern, she'll have a lot more luck than if it's just every now and then.
